NEW CONSTELLATIONS Adds Shad, Narcy, Desmond Cole,
and David Chariandy as Performers
– One-of-a-kind tour kicked off in Saskatoon last night –
– Tickets sold out in Calgary, Edmonton, Winnipeg, and Toronto  – 

____________________________________________


Kicking off last night in Saskatoon, NEW CONSTELLATIONS’ buses hit the road this week with a one-of-a-kind, cross-country tour of music and arts, and is set to make its Western Canada stops in Saskatoon, Calgary, Edmonton, Prince Albert, Winnipeg, and Wiikwemkoong. With tickets already sold out for the Calgary, Edmonton, and Winnipeg shows, as well as the closing night show in Toronto, excitement is spreading fast nation(s)wide.
NEW CONSTELLATIONS also announces four exciting additions to the performance lineup to the incredible talent roster. Hip-hop artist and JUNO Award winner Shad, who hosts Emmy award-winning and Peabody award-winning documentary series Hip Hop Evolution (HBO Canada / Netflix), and Montreal-based Iraqi-Canadian hip-hop artist and educator Narcy, who starred in and directed “R.E.D.”, the MMVA award-winning video for Indigenous super-group A Tribe Called Red, have both been added to the Ottawa lineup on December 9. Shad and Narcy were previously announced as Digital Mentors in the NEW CONSTELLATIONS Mentorship Program, sharing their talent and expertise with Indigenous aspiring musicians. Celebrated Toronto-based journalist and activist Desmond Cole, and 2017 Rogers Writers’ Trust Fiction Prize winner David Chariandy help celebrate the special closing night of NEW CONSTELLATIONS, with literary performances in Toronto on December 20.
The four newly added performers join some of the country’s most celebrated musicians, writers, and poets. The interstellar lineup of Indigenous and non-Indigenous music and literary artists coming together for the first time, include: Feist, A Tribe Called Red, July Talk, Lido Pimienta, Leanne Betasamosake Simpson, Naomi Klein, Sam Roberts, Weaves, Jason Collett, Stars, Joel Plaskett, Leonard Sumner, Jeremy Dutcher, Mob Bounce, George​ ​Elliott Clarke, Jordan Abel, Rich Aucoin, Heather O’Neill, La Force and many more. With a commitment to giving back to the Indigenous community, NEW CONSTELLATIONS also features a two-part Mentorship program.The Digital Mentorship program offers one-on-one mentorship from established artists including Anishinaabe electronic musician DJ NDN, Iraqi-Canadian hip-hop artist, educator, and MMVA award-winning video director Narcy, 2017 Polaris Prize Winner Lido Pimienta, Cree/Dene musician IsKwé, singer Jasmyn Burke (Weaves), JUNO Award-winning hip-hop artist Shad, and multidisciplinary ​Métis​ ​artist​ ​​Moe​ ​Clark, while In-Community Workshops hosted at six tour stops, including two Indigenous communities, allow Indigenous youth to learn creative writing, songwriting, music creation, and DJ/production skills with artists from the tour and local artist mentors. Registration for In-Community workshops remains open in Fredericton and Kitigan Zibi. NEW CONSTELLATIONS offers new possibilities for creative collaboration across communities. NEW CONSTELLATIONS is the brainchild of The Basement Revue and Revolutions Per Minute (RPM), two successful music organizations that have partnered to co-curate this national celebration of creative collaboration. The tour is presented with support from the National Centre for Truth and Reconciliation at the University of Manitoba and the Government of Canada.

About NEW CONSTELLATIONS
NEW CONSTELLATIONS is a nation(s)wide tour of music and arts, featuring special guest appearances by an interstellar lineup of Indigenous and non-Indigenous artists. The project includes a 13-stop tour, a mentorship program and community-based arts and music workshop series for Indigenous youth, digital curriculum, and a tour documentary film.
